WebMay 24, 2024 · But the song became a bigger hit and eventually became a signature song for Aretha Franklin when she released her version in 1967. With Franklin’s version, the song became a declaration from a strong, capable and confident woman who deserves respect and demands it from her man. Aretha’s has its alterations from Otis Redding’s version.

WebJun 10, 2016 · “Respect” is Aretha Franklin’s signature song and the first of her two No. 1 singles on the Hot 100. But the song was not written for her, nor was she the first artist to cut the composition. WebRespect by Aretha Franklin was written by Otis Redding and was first recorded and released by Otis Redding in 1965. Aretha Franklin released it on the album I Never Loved a Man the Way I Love You in 1967.
